Take a treasure hunt

Celebrate Chicago’s architecture with more than 100 free tours offered May 16 during the Great Chicago Places and Spaces event. Check out two tours designed specifically for kids:

Animals in Architecture (walking)

10 a.m. and 12:30 p.m.

Discover some of the animals designed as part of buildings. Strollers permitted. RSVP with the number of adults and children to education@architecture.org.

Chicago Cultural Center& Millennium Park Treasure Hunt (walking)

9 a.m.-4 p.m.

Pick up a treasure map at the information desk at the Chicago Cultural Center or the Millennium Park Welcome Center.

For more information on the tours, visit

www.greatchicagoplaces.us or call (312) 744-3315.
